The NPE JavaDoc explicitly says, "other illegal uses of the null object". If it was just limited to situations where the runtime encounters a null when it shouldn't, all such cases could be defined far more succinctly.
Can't help it if you assume the wrong thing, but assuming encapsulation is applied properly, you really shouldn't care or notice whether a null was dereferenced inappropriately vs. whether a method detected an inappropriate null and fired an exception off.
I'd choose NPE over IAE for multiple reasons
- It is more specific about the nature of the illegal operation
- Logic that mistakenly allows nulls tends to be very different from logic that mistakenly allows illegal values. For example, if I'm validating data entered by a user, if I get value that is unacceptable, the source of that error is with the end user of the application. If I get a null, that's programmer error.
- Invalid values can cause things like stack overflows, out of memory errors, parsing exceptions, etc. Indeed, most errors generally present, at some point, as an invalid value in some method call. For this reason I see IAE as actually the MOST GENERAL of all exceptions under RuntimeException.
Actually, other invalid arguments can result in all kinds of other exceptions. UnknownHostException, FileNotFoundException, a variety of syntax error exceptions, IndexOutOfBoundsException, authentication failures, etc., etc.
In general, I feel NPE is much maligned because traditionally has been associated with code that fails to follow the fail fast principle. That, plus the JDK's failure to populate NPE's with a message string really has created a strong negative sentiment that isn't well founded. Indeed, the difference between NPE and IAE from a runtime perspective is strictly the name. From that perspective, the more precise you are with the name, the more clarity you give to the caller.
